Default new intake & throttle body

I'm thinking about picking up a new intake and throttle body for my Z. I'm not really expecting too much of a power gain, maybe just enough to be noticeable. I'm just trying to help the engine breath a little easier. I'm not really sure what I'm looking for, I'm very much new to nissan. I was eyeing the throttle body on 350evo, and the AEM CAI. I know that AEM did a fantastic job with their CAI for the old saturns (yeah.. saturn, I know). They managed to engineer a rut in the HP curve right out of the engine, just with the intake. Does anyone have any opinions or experience with either?

THe AEM intake is a good intake for the Z. But, i'll tell you from personal experience, no matter what intake you go with, it's only a modest gain at best. The Z's intake is pretty good stock. Sure there is HP to be gained, but not a whole lot of difference between intakes available. The best bang for the buck, and by far most popular are the JWT pop-chargers.
Next in line are the Nismo intakes.
I have the most expensive intake you can get for this car, the gruppe m, and it's not worth the money, just bling factor, lol.
In this case, cheaper is probably better if budget is a concern. Cold air intakes produce more hp than the JWT, but it's not really noticeable, and thus for the extra money, not really worth it.
